when i got my car it was squeaking. i replaced it and my clutch 1500-2000 miles later the new one started squeaking. (it's been awhile since it started again) so i replaced it and sent my car to the shop and got it back on friday and the new one is starting to squeak. what would cause this the guy at auto zone said that i probably got a bad one when the first one i put on started but i think that the odds of that happening twice in a row are slim

Does it squeak all the time?  Or just when there's a load on it (when the clutch pedal IS NOT depressed)? 

Really sounds to me like your t.o.b. retainer is bad.  I had to replace mine about a year ago.
